Walton 13th National Cricket League 2011-12

Rajshahi's fifth win

Rajshahi racked up a fifth win in the first phase of the National Cricket League when they beat Barisal by 175 runs at the Shamsul Huda Stadium in Jessore yesterday.
Dhiman Ghosh and Alauddin Babu smashed big centuries in Rangpur's dominating second innings while Khulna controlled their game over Dhaka Metropolis.
Sylhet also have an eye on victory as they require less than a hundred runs for victory over Dhaka.
RAJSHAHI-BARISAL
Rajshahi finished off Barisal inside three days, despite an excellent all-round show from Sohag Gazi.
The defending champions rode on half-centuries from Junaed Siddiqui and Mizanur Rahman to set Barisal, who trailed by six runs in the first dig, a target of 320 runs. Farhad Hossain's accurate off-spin yielded four wickets while Saqlain Sajib took three as Barisal were bowled out for 144 runs in just 31.4 overs.
Sohag struck a couple of half-centuries and picked up nine wickets in the game.
RANGPUR-CHITTAGONG
After the first day chaos in Bogra when 20 wickets fell, Rangpur responded in the most unbelievable manner.
Alauddin and Dhiman struck 180 and 183 respectively during their mammoth 322-run fifth wicket stand. The all-rounder Alauddin was the aggressor of the pair, hammering 22 boundaries and a six during his 207-ball innings. Dhiman struck 26 fours and a six in his 245-ball stay.
Later, Tanvir Haider and Ariful Haque threw their bat around as they took the score past the 550-mark.
Chittagong responded to the second innings chase with 189-3 at stumps at the Shaheed Chandu Stadium.
KHULNA-DHAKA METRO
Dhaka Metro will miss the services of Mohammad Ashraful in the second innings as their captain was called up to the national team for the Test matches against Pakistan.
It would mean that they would require a further 200 runs with four wickets in hand after they ended the third day on 143-5 at the Shaheed Kamruzzaman Stadium in Rajshahi.
Earlier, Khulna's all-rounder Soumya Sarkar struck 80 in the side's 250 all out after Dhaka Metro declared their first innings on 164-8.
Alamin Hossain took two second innings wickets after he took a five-wicket haul for Khulna in the first innings.
DHAKA-SYLHET
After Sylhet took a 110-run lead in the first innings at their home ground, Dhaka were bowled out for 231 runs with left-arm spinner Enamul Haque picking up three wickets.
Opener Abdul Majid made 92 off 192 balls with the help of a dozen boundaries and a six.
With 122 runs to win, Sylhet responded with 34-1 with Imtiaz Ahmed unbeaten on 23 runs. They made 285 in the first innings with Enamul top scoring with 54 runs.
